What’s an angel number?

An angel number is a number that contains a powerful message. It’s sent to you by your guardian angels, your spirit guides, the universe, your intuition, a higher power—however you conceive of it. By decoding the numerology of the particular angel number that’s following you around, you can understand what you need to know right now, whether that’s a reassurance that you’re heading in the right direction or an urge to change your path.

What does angel number 2121 mean?

There are several ways to look at 2121. Taken as a whole, 2121 indicates a message of self-reflection and perseverance, according to Deciphering Angel Numbers by April Wall. If you’ve been engaged in a period of self-reflection, keep it up, because you’re headed towards a breakthrough. If you haven’t been self-reflecting, well, now is the time to start.

You can also look at 2121 as two repeating 21s, which carry a message of patience, acceptance, and laughter, according to Wall. You might be working towards a particular goal or hoping for a particular thing to happen, but this number is a reminder that it takes hard work and patience to get to where you want to go. Keep at it—and remember that the journey should be fun, too.

Alternately, you can look at 2121 as two 2s, holding a message of balance and decision-making, and two 1s, carrying a meaning of independence and bravery. Taken together, this number can remind you to be considerate of when you need to work with others and when you need to work alone.

Finally, 2121 can be reduced to 2+1+2+1=6. In numerology, 6 indicates peace, service, and family. If you’ve been going through a tough time, this number is an indication that brighter days are ahead. 

What does angel number 2121 mean for love?

In love, angel number 2121 can be seen as a reminder to find a balance between the time and energy you’re dedicating to your relationship and the energy you’re focusing on your own self-development. Don’t let your own individuality disappear into your relationship and instead find a balance that works for you.

What does angel number 2121 mean for my career?

If you’ve been working hard towards a promotion or a raise, searching for a new job, or launching your own business, angel number 2121 is a message that all your hard work will soon pay off. Keep up the hard work, because results are coming soon! This number can also be seen as a reminder that you need to have work-life balance. Don’t burn yourself out by putting all your energy into a workplace that doesn’t give you anything back.

What should I do if I keep seeing angel number 2121?

If you keep seeing angel number 2121, know that your angels, spirit guides, and/or the universe (however you see it) is sending you an important message. Consider the areas of your life in which you’re working towards a goal, and the areas in which you might need to find more balance. Then, get to work!
